    HEARING OFFICER ORDER
     
    On April 28, 2005, all parties participated in a telephonic status conference with the
    hearing officer. The complainant represented that the stipulation and proposal for settlement
    (stipulation) is being circulated for signatures. It was agreed that respondent’s response to
    complainant’s motion to strike or dismiss respondent’s defenses be stayed. That request is
    granted and will be discussed at the next status conference if needed.
    The parties or their legal representatives are directed to participate in a telephonic status
    conference with the hearing officer on June 29, 2005, at 9:45 a.m. The telephonic status
    conference must be initiated by the complainant, but each party is nonetheless responsible for its
    own appearance. At the status conference, the parties must be prepared to discuss the status of
    the above-captioned matter and their readiness for hearing. If, however, a stipulation is filed
    prior to the next status conference, the conference will be cancelled without further order.
    IT IS SO ORDERED.
